What is it?

Overactive bladder (OAB) involves urgency, frequent urination, and often night waking (nocturia). It can also link with urge incontinence (leaking with urgency)

How we treat it at Alaga

• Bladder diary + trigger mapping (habits, timing, fluids, urgency cues) • Urge suppression strategies (what to do in the moment) • Bladder training (gradual retraining of frequency) • Pelvic floor coordination (often about calming + timing, not just strength) • Lifestyle strategies (sleep, stress, caffeine, hydration) tailored to you

Why Alaga for OAB?

We retrain, not restrict

No extreme rules — just evidence-based behaviour change that works.

Nervous system aware

Urgency is a signal problem as much as a bladder problem.

Long-term confidence

So you’re not planning your life around toilets.

How we calm urgency

01

Track your baseline

Frequency, triggers, and patterns (hello, bladder diary).
